Description

1,3-Benzenedicarboxylic Acid, Polymer With 2,5-Furandione, 1,3-Isobenzofurandione And 1,2-Propanediol is a high-performance, synthetic polymer resin designed for demanding industrial applications. This specialized copolymer offers a unique combination of thermal stability, chemical resistance, and mechanical properties derived from its aromatic and anhydride-based monomers. It is primarily utilized by manufacturers in the coatings, adhesives, and advanced composite materials sectors seeking to enhance product durability and performance.

Application

  • As a key resin component in high-temperature resistant industrial coatings and enamels.
  • In the formulation of specialty adhesives and sealants requiring excellent chemical and environmental stability.
  • As a modifier or cross-linking agent in epoxy and polyester resin systems for composite materials.
  • In the production of electrical insulation materials, such as wire enamels and potting compounds.
  • For manufacturing corrosion-resistant linings and protective layers in chemical processing equipment.
  • As a binder or film-forming agent in advanced pigment dispersions and printing inks.

Basic Information

Product Name 1,3-Benzenedicarboxylic Acid, Polymer With 2,5-Furandione, 1,3-Isobenzofurandione And 1,2-Propanediol
CAS No. 50328-12-6
Molecular Formula (C8H6O4 · C4H2O3 · C8H4O3 · C3H8O2)n
Molecular Weight Polymer - Contact for details
Synonyms Isophthalic Acid - Maleic Anhydride - Phthalic Anhydride - Propylene Glycol Copolymer; Poly(isophthalic acid-co-maleic anhydride-co-phthalic anhydride-co-propylene glycol); IPA/MA/PA/PG Copolymer; Isophthalic Acid Polymer with Maleic Anhydride, Phthalic Anhydride and Propylene Glycol; Thermosetting Polyester Resin Precursor; Unsaturated Polyester Resin Intermediate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from heat sources, open flames, and incompatible materials such as strong bases and amines. The product may be hygroscopic; ensure containers are sealed after each use to minimize moisture absorption.
